Painted Pots lets customers choose and paint their own pottery. The store has teapots in multiple sizes. Rebecca chose to paint the largest teapot offered, which cost $18. She also painted 4 small teacups to go with her teapot. Rebecca spent a total of $42 on pottery.
Which equation can you use to find c, the cost of each teacup?
What was the cost of each teacup?

The equation that can be use to find c, the cost of each teacup is

42 = 18 + 4c

The cost of each teacups is $6

c = cost of each teacup.

The store has teapots in multiple sizes.

She spent a total of $42 on the pottery.

Cost of painting the largest teapot = $18

She also painted 4 small teacups to go with her teapots

Therefore, the equation that can be use to find c, the cost of each teacup can be represented below:

42 = 18 + 4c

The cost of each teacups can be calculated below:

42 = 18 + 4c

42 - 18 = 4c

24 = 4c

c = 24 / 4

c = $6
